Part 4: How to Flash a VU Solo2 Backup Image (Step-by-Step)

Method A: Using the Software Manager (GUI)

Most modern Enigma2 images (OpenPLi, OpenATV, etc.) have a built-in backup tool.

  1. Insert a USB stick or ensure your Hard Drive is mounted.
  2. Press the Menu button on your remote.
  3. Navigate to Setup > System > Software Management (or "Flash Image" / "Backup/Restore" depending on the image).
  4. Look for an option labeled "Backup Image" or "Create Backup".
  5. Select your destination (USB or HDD).
  6. The receiver will compress the current system files into a backup image file (usually ending in .usb.zip or similar).
  7. Once finished, you can copy this file from the USB/HDD to your PC for safekeeping.
